Hallo allerseits,

Arne Babenhauserheide ſchrieb am 03.10.2010 21:45 Uhr:
Rechner können im Hintergrund laufen (v.a. mit mehreren Prozessoren), ich habe leider nur eine Tastatur und begrenzte Zeit :)

Gutes Argument! Hier lesen ja viele Computer-Affine mit, da sollten schon noch ein paar unterforderte Rechner mit dabei sein :). Apropos: Wäre es ohne großen Aufwand möglich, dem evaluation.py-Skript eine rudimentäre Fortschrittsanzeige zu spendieren? So etwas wie ein "*" auf der Konsole alle 100 Iterationen? Ich frage, da ich das Skript eben nach zwei Stunden auf meinem Rechner¹ abgebrochen habe, da ich mir einfach nicht sicher war, ob das heute noch terminieren wird (obwohl ein Kern voll ausgelastet war).

(und wir haben auch keine 5 Vollzeit-Programmierer – schon in Python hat das Programm ein >9 Monate gebraucht, in C(++) wäre es deutlich mehr…

Das glaube ich auch! Wobei C(++) noch nicht einmal unbedingt die schnellste Lösung wäre … man könnte die rechenintensiven Teile auch via OpenCL in die Grafikkarte auslagern – und dann bräuchten wir noch ein paar Gamer-Rechner ;).


Viele Grüße,
Dennis-ſ


¹ Intel Pentium D 2.80 GHz, 2 GB Arbeitsſpeicher, Ubuntu 10.4


Antwort per Email an